The Science Behind Refrigerator Temperature
The temperature inside a fridge is controlled by a complex system of compressors, condensers, and evaporators. The refrigeration unit, usually located at the back or bottom of the fridge, is responsible for cooling the air inside the appliance. As the refrigerant flows through the evaporator coils, it absorbs heat from the surrounding air, causing the temperature to drop. The cooled air then circulates throughout the fridge, maintaining a consistent temperature.
Factors Affecting Temperature Distribution
Several factors can affect the temperature distribution within a fridge, including:
the placement of shelves and drawers, which can obstruct airflow and create warm spots
the type and quantity of food stored, which can release heat and moisture into the air
the frequency of door openings, which can let warm air into the fridge
the age and maintenance of the refrigeration unit, which can impact its efficiency and performance
Locating the Coldest Spot in a Fridge
So, where is the coldest spot in a fridge? The answer lies in the bottom shelf, usually the lowest shelf in the fridge, near the back. This area is often referred to as the “coldest zone” because it is closest to the refrigeration unit and receives the coolest air. The temperature in this zone can be as low as 37°F (3°C), making it the ideal place to store perishable items like meat, dairy products, and eggs.
Why the Bottom Shelf is the Coldest
There are several reasons why the bottom shelf is the coldest spot in a fridge:
- Cool air settles at the bottom: As the refrigeration unit cools the air, it becomes denser and settles at the bottom of the fridge, creating a cooler environment.
- Proximity to the refrigeration unit: The bottom shelf is usually located near the refrigeration unit, which means it receives the coolest air directly from the source.

What is the ideal temperature for a fridge to maintain optimal food storage?
The ideal temperature for a fridge is between 37°F and 40°F (3°C and 4°C). This temperature range is crucial in slowing down the growth of bacteria and other microorganisms that can cause food spoilage. It is essential to note that the temperature inside the fridge can vary depending on several factors, including the type of fridge, its age, and how well it is maintained. Regularly checking the temperature and ensuring it remains within the ideal range can help maintain optimal food storage conditions.

How does humidity affect food storage in a fridge, and how can it be controlled?
Humidity plays a significant role in food storage, as high levels of moisture can lead to the growth of mold and bacteria. In a fridge, humidity can be controlled by using airtight containers, covering foods, and ensuring proper air circulation. The crisper drawer, which is designed to maintain high humidity, is ideal for storing fruits and vegetables. On the other hand, the main compartment of the fridge should have lower humidity to prevent moisture from accumulating and affecting other foods.
